Recognizing the Tummy Tuck Treatment



A belly put, or tummy tuck, is a prominent cosmetic surgical treatment made to squash your tummy by getting rid of excess skin and fat. During the treatment, your specialist makes a straight incision throughout your reduced abdominal areas, enabling them to accessibility and tighten the underlying muscle mass. They'll additionally get rid of any kind of sagging skin, leading to a smoother, stronger look.




You'll generally get basic anesthetic, making sure you fit throughout the surgery. The operation can take several hours, depending upon your specific demands. Afterward, you'll have drains pipes placed to aid get rid of liquid buildup and guarantee appropriate healing.


Anticipate some swelling and pain as you recoup, however your cosmetic surgeon will certainly offer pain monitoring choices. It's important to comply with post-operative treatment directions carefully to achieve the finest results. You'll likely discover a significant adjustment in your body shape, improving your self-confidence and boosting your general look.


Pre-Surgery Preparations



Prior to your tummy tuck surgical treatment, it's vital to take several primary steps to ensure a smooth experience. Begin by setting up a complete examination with your cosmetic surgeon. Review your case history, any kind of medications you're taking, and your expectations for the procedure.


You'll likely need to stop smoking and avoid certain medications like aspirin and anti-inflammatory drugs to decrease the risk of problems. It's also essential to preserve a healthy diet plan and remain hydrated in the weeks leading up to your surgical treatment.


Prepare your healing area at home by stocking up on supplies like comfortable clothing, discomfort relievers, and easy-to-eat meals. Arrange for somebody to aid you throughout the very first few days post-surgery, as wheelchair will be limited. Lastly, follow your specialist's certain directions carefully to make certain you're in the ideal form possible for your tummy put and recuperation.

Injury Care Recommendations



To assure a smooth healing from your tummy put surgical procedure, it is critical to follow your surgeon's wound care directions carefully. Keep the medical location dry and clean. Adjustment dressings as directed, and always clean your hands before touching the site. If you see any type of indications of infection-- such as raised inflammation, swelling, or discharge-- contact your doctor quickly. You need to avoid laborious tasks and heavy lifting for a number of weeks to stop complications. Furthermore, do not take in baths or swimming pools till your specialist offers you the thumbs-up. Staying hydrated and complying with a healthy and balanced diet plan can likewise help in recovery. Bear in mind, your body needs time to recover, so be alert and patient to your injury treatment for the most effective outcomes.


Recovery Timeline and Expectations



Recovery from abdominoplasty surgical treatment typically unfolds over numerous weeks, with each stage providing distinct assumptions and turning points. In the very first week, you'll concentrate on remainder and begin gentle activities to help circulation. Do not be shocked if you feel rigidity or swelling; this is typical as your body begins recovery.


By week two, you can gradually boost your activity degree, yet pay attention to your body. You may still need support with daily jobs, as flexibility can be limited. Around the third week, several individuals go back to light work and day-to-day routines, though difficult activities ought to still be stayed clear of.


After about four to 6 weeks, you'll likely notice substantial enhancements in your wheelchair and comfort. Full healing can take several months, so be patient as your body changes. Remember to follow your surgeon's site standards to assure a smooth healing and ideal outcomes.

Frequently Asked Inquiries



Will I Have Visible Scars After My Stomach Put?



Yes, you'll likely have visible marks after your tummy put. However, the specialist will position incisions tactically to decrease their appearance. In time, these marks might fade and end up being much less visible with appropriate care.

Can I Have Children After an Abdominoplasty?



Yes, you can have youngsters after an abdominoplasty. It's typically recommended to wait up until you're done having children. Maternity can stretch your abdominal skin once again, possibly impacting your medical results.


Exactly How Much Weight Can I Shed From a Belly Tuck?



You can typically lose around 5 to 10 extra pounds click here for more info from a belly tuck, relying on individual situations. Nevertheless, it's not a weight-loss procedure; it mainly concentrates on tightening up and contouring your stomach location.


Exist Any Kind Of Age Constraints for Tummy Put Surgical Treatment?



There aren't rigorous age constraints for abdominoplasty surgical procedure, but many doctors like people to be at least 18. Your overall health and skin elasticity play a bigger role in determining your eligibility.


Will Insurance Cover My Abdominoplasty Procedure?



Insurance coverage normally does not cover tummy tuck treatments because they're typically taken into consideration cosmetic. If you have medical reasons, like substantial weight loss or stomach problems, it's worth going over with your supplier to explore your options.
